About
Fabulous High ceiling corner 2-bedroom, 2-bath home full-service boutique condominium with only 4 units per floor, in the best part of Chelsea, Enter thru an oversized solid-wood door that flows into the 21Ft Living-Dining space, filled with south-east light through enormous aluminum-framed windows with custom blinds. The open, windowed chef's kitchen has granite countertops, Viking stove, fridge & dishwasher, and garbage disposal.

If you're looking for a staid, quiet place to live, Chelsea is not for you. Its thriving arts scene has always been a big draw for creative types. Not surprisingly, residents pay a high price to live in such a hip and happening part of Manhattan. The neighborhood has some of the most exclusive restaurants and bars in the city, and real estate prices are steep — especially for new condos along the High Line.
Slip down many of the side streets, however, and you're likely to find some beautiful and historic townhouses nestled gracefully within the neighborhood's hustle and bustle.
